Job Description

Key Duties
Acts as the lead subject matter expert in AI, automation, and full‑stack software engineering on an agile delivery team, collaborating with product owners, designers, and engineers to deliver business value iteratively.
Coordinates and leads the technical delivery of a team of approximately 7 engineers, including setting technical direction, aligning priorities, planning work, and driving execution through influence.
Acts as the technology SME for AI and automation for product teams, often representing multiple teams to business stakeholders and leadership.
Architects, engineers, tests, and releases highly scalable, secure, and maintainable end‑to‑end solutions, combining:
Custom software and APIs
Cloud‑based AI services (e.g., LLMs, cognitive services, AI Builder)
Microsoft Power Apps and Power Automate workflows.
Ensures delivery of high‑quality software and automation solutions through clean coding practices, pair programming, test‑driven development (TDD), continuous integration, code reviews, and appropriate monitoring and observability for AI‑enabled workflows.
Influences development of technology strategy for AI, automation, and low/no‑code platforms, aligned with department and enterprise goals, and helps teams execute against that strategy.
Partners closely with business stakeholders to understand processes, guest and employee journeys, and operational pain points; translates needs into effective AI‑powered and automated solutions.
Facilitates design sessions, reviews, and demos, clearly communicating trade‑offs and technical concepts to both technical and non‑technical audiences.
Actively engages in the technology industry by applying emerging concepts in AI/ML, large language models, and low/no‑code development, and by networking and speaking on behalf of Alaska at conferences and meetups.
Influences technology and AI maturity across divisions and leadership levels, advocating for responsible AI use, governance, and sustainable automation practices.
Leverages a deep understanding of guest experience, business operations, and systems to mentor engineers and citizen developers across multiple teams.
Job-Specific Experience, Education & Skills
Required
7 years of experience in software engineering or a related area.
Bachelor’s degree with a focus in Computer Science or a related field, or an additional two years of relevant training/experience in lieu of this degree.
Experience must include:
Acting as a full‑stack software engineer building custom, high‑scale, n‑tier applications using object‑oriented languages (e.g., C#, Java, etc.).
Utilizing appropriate design patterns to create clean, maintainable, and performant code.
Expertise utilizing cloud technologies and modern architecture practices to build high‑scale distributed systems.
Leading and coordinating the technical delivery of an engineering team of seven (7) or more engineers, including setting technical direction, mentoring, aligning priorities, and ensuring delivery and quality outcomes.
Hands‑on experience delivering AI‑enabled or advanced automation solutions, such as integrating AI/ML or LLM‑based services into applications or workflows.
Experience building solutions using low/no‑code or workflow automation platforms, preferably Microsoft Power Platform (Power Apps and/or Power Automate).
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to drive adoption of new ideas and technologies, particularly AI and automation, across engineering and business communities.

Required Skills & Experience

Experience with the Microsoft technology stack, including .NET framework, .NET Core, MS SQL, and Azure cloud.
Experience leading large or complex technical initiatives spanning multiple teams or domains.
Experience with containers and container technologies, including Docker, Kubernetes, and OpenShift.
Experience with unit testing and functional test automation (front and back end).
Deep experience with AI/ML, including one or more of:
Large language models (LLMs)
Azure OpenAI Service or Azure Cognitive Services
AI Builder or similar cloud AI platforms
Experience delivering solutions on Microsoft Power Platform, including Power Apps, Power Automate, and custom connectors.
Experience with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) practices.
Experience with DevOps practices and tools, particularly Azure DevOps.
Experience in Agile development methodologies.
Experience negotiating requirements directly with stakeholders, including leading discovery or design workshops.
Experience enabling and mentoring citizen developers or business power users within a governed low/no‑code environment.
